OCTOBER BUSINESS OF THE MONTH
Penfield Chiropractic Office 1638 Penfield Road, Penfield 585-385-6700
Dr. Doyle selected his career early on while he was a biology major in college. He decided that he wanted a career in health care that would allow him to treat patients without having to rely on invasive surgery or medications. He was intrigued by the wholistic philosophy and treatment methodology that chiropractic utilized and felt that it was a good career fit.
Dr. Doyle opened his chiropractic office at 1638 Penfield Road over 28 years ago. He is a solo practitioner so all patients see Dr. Doyle himself. (more)

THURSDAY, NOVEMBER 17: PBA/RBA Speed Networking Event
7:30am - 9:30am
Rochester Business Alliance 150 State Street, 3rd Floor, Room 301
Networking made easy. Don't let the idea of networking intimidate you. Speed networking offers a twist on the typical meet-and-greet, an organized succession of brief conversations among participants that allows you to talk briefly with 20 or more people over the course of the evening. Participants should bring a stack of their own business cards and be prepared with a brief pitch about yourself and your business. Limit of two employees from a company: space is limited. Participants must be present at the entire event
The cost is $15.00 for PBA members ($35 discount off of the RBA non-member rate)

PBA Board of Director elections take place each November at our general membership meeting. There are 12 seats on the Board of Directors and a term is for two years. Each year we elect 6 of the 12 Directors.
